DPS Resources Bhd  (XKLS:7198) Cash Ratio Explanation

The cash ratio is more conservative than other liquidity ratios, such as Quick Ratio and Current Ratio, because it only considers a company's most liquid resources. The numerator of cash ratio only considers Cash, Cash Equivalents and marketable securities. Other current assets, such as accounts receivable and inventories, are not included. The rationale is that these assets may require time to be transformed into cash, and the amount of money received is also uncertain.

The cash ratio shows a company’s ability to pay all current liabilities immediately without selling or liquidating other assets. Generally speaking, a higher cash ratio suggests the company has a stronger ability to cover its short-term debt. However, a high cash ratio could also indicate inefficient management: the company is inefficient in making full utilization of cash to invest protential profitable project. It may also suggest that the company is not confident about future profitability.

In general, the higher the cash ratio, the better the company's liquidity position.

DPS Resources Bhd Cash Ratio Calculation

The Cash Ratio measures a company's ability to meet its short-term obligations with its cash and near-cash resources.

DPS Resources Bhd's Cash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

Cash Ratio (A: Mar. 2026 )=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ities/Total Current Liabilities
=4.809/18.176
=0.26

DPS Resources Bhd Business Description

Address Lot 76, Kawasan Perindustrian Bukit Rambai, Bukit Rambai, Melaka, MLA, MYS, 75250
DPS Resources Bhd is an investment holding company. The company's operating segment includes Investment holding; Manufacturing and Trading; Property development services; Construction services, Rental income, and Real estate. It generates maximum revenue from the manufacturing and trading segment. The manufacturing and trading segment is engaged in the manufacturing and trading of furniture and roof trusses, and the provision of kiln-drying services. Its Property development services carry on the business of real property and housing development-related services. Geographically, it derives a majority of its revenue from Malaysia and also has a presence in the Asia Pacific, the United States, Europe, the Middle East, and Africa.
